/*CSS STYLESHEET DESIGNED BY TEMPLATEMONSTER CO.*/
/*GLOBAL STYLES START*/

/*remove focus on all */
*:focus { outline: 0; }

*{padding:0; margin:0;}
body{background:url(images/back.gif) repeat-x top #E4E8EA; font-family:Tahoma; font-size:11px; line-height:14px; color:#676767; text-align:left;}
img {border:0;}
input {vertical-align:middle;}
textarea{font-family:Tahoma;}
input {height:20px;}
.column {float:left;}
.clear {clear:both;}


.roundT_topside{background:url(images/side.gif) repeat-x top #FFFFFF;}
.roundT_bottside{background:url(images/side.gif) repeat-x bottom;}
.roundT_leftside{background:url(images/side.gif) repeat-y left ;}
.roundT_rightside{background:url(images/side.gif) repeat-y right;}
.roundT_ltc{background:url(images/ltc.gif) no-repeat left top;}
.roundT_rtc{background:url(images/rtc.gif) no-repeat right top;}
.roundT_lbc{background:url(images/lbc.gif) no-repeat left bottom;}
.roundT_rbc{background:url(images/rbc.gif) no-repeat right bottom;}

/*do not make any change here to prevent design brake!!!*/
#header{height:299px; background:url(images/back.gif) repeat-x top #FFFFFF;}
#header .col1{float:left; width:241px; background:url(images/h_back2.gif) repeat-x top #FFFFFF;}
#header .col2{float:left; width:302px; background:url(images/h_back.jpg) no-repeat left top;}
#header .col2 img{margin:248px 0 18px 28px;}
#header .col3{float:left; width:222px; background:url(images/h_back1.gif) no-repeat 0 0 #B6BEC3; height:299px;}
#header .col3 .indent{margin-left:28px; margin-right:10px;}

#header3{height:299px; background:url(images/back.gif) repeat-x top #FFFFFF;}
#header3 .col1{float:left; width:241px; background:url(images/h_back2.gif) repeat-x top #FFFFFF;}
#header3 .col2{float:left; width:302px; background:url(images/h_back3.jpg) no-repeat left top;}
#header3 .col2 img{margin:248px 0 18px 28px;}
#header3 .col3{float:left; width:222px; background:url(images/h_back1.gif) no-repeat 0 0 #B6BEC3; height:299px;}
#header3 .col3 .indent{margin-left:28px; margin-right:10px;}

#header4{height:299px; background:url(images/back.gif) repeat-x top #FFFFFF;}
#header4 .col1{float:left; width:241px; background:url(images/h_back2.gif) repeat-x top #FFFFFF;}
#header4 .col2{float:left; width:302px; background:url(images/h_back4.jpg) no-repeat left top;}
#header4 .col2 img{margin:248px 0 18px 28px;}
#header4 .col3{float:left; width:222px; background:url(images/h_back1.gif) no-repeat 0 0 #B6BEC3; height:299px;}
#header4 .col3 .indent{margin-left:28px; margin-right:10px;}

#header2{height:299px; background:url(images/back.gif) repeat-x top #FFFFFF;}
#header2 .col1{float:left; width:241px; background:url(images/h_back2.gif) repeat-x top #FFFFFF;}
#header2 .col2{float:left; width:302px; background:url(images/h_back2.jpg) no-repeat left top;}
#header2 .col2 img{margin:248px 0 18px 28px;}
#header2 .col3{float:left; width:222px; background:url(images/h_back1.gif) no-repeat 0 0 #B6BEC3; height:299px;}
#header2 .col3 .indent{margin-left:28px; margin-right:10px;}

#header5{height:299px; background:url(images/back.gif) repeat-x top #FFFFFF;}
#header5 .col1{float:left; width:241px; background:url(images/h_back2.gif) repeat-x top #FFFFFF;}
#header5 .col2{float:left; width:302px; background:url(images/h_back5.jpg) no-repeat left top;}
#header5 .col2 img{margin:248px 0 18px 28px;}
#header5 .col3{float:left; width:222px; background:url(images/h_back1.gif) no-repeat 0 0 #B6BEC3; height:299px;}
#header5 .col3 .indent{margin-left:28px; margin-right:10px;}

#header6{height:299px; background:url(images/back.gif) repeat-x top #FFFFFF;}
#header6 .col1{float:left; width:241px; background:url(images/h_back2.gif) repeat-x top #FFFFFF;}
#header6 .col2{float:left; width:302px; background:url(images/h_back6.jpg) no-repeat left top;}
#header6 .col2 img{margin:248px 0 18px 28px;}
#header6 .col3{float:left; width:222px; background:url(images/h_back1.gif) no-repeat 0 0 #B6BEC3; height:299px;}
#header6 .col3 .indent{margin-left:28px; margin-right:10px;}

#footer{width:766px; text-align:left; color:#7F8D95}
#footer a {color:#7F8D95; text-decoration:none;}
#footer a:hover{text-decoration:underline;}
#footer .col1{width:573px; float:left;}
#footer .col1 .indent{ margin:30px 0 25px 35px;}
#footer .col2{width:190px; float:left;}
#footer .col2 .indent{ margin:30px 0 25px 0;}
/*GLOBAL STYLES END*/
/*********************************************************************************************************/
/*FORMS CLASSES START*/
.form_total{padding:0 0 0 3px; vertical-align:middle; background:#ffffff; color:#000000; font-size:11px; line-height:20px; border: solid 1px #D3D3D3;}
.form_1 {width:210px; height:20px;}
/*FORMS CLASSES END*/
/*LIST CLASSES START*/
ul {list-style:none; }
li {background:url(images/pimp1.gif) no-repeat 0px 7px; padding-left:9px; line-height:18px; color:#348CBC; }
li a {text-decoration:underline; color:#348CBC; line-height:18px;}
li a:hover {text-decoration:none;}


/*LIST CLASSES END*/
/*LINKS START*/
a {color:#348CBC; text-decoration:underline; outline: 0;}
a:hover{ text-decoration:none; mar}

.link1 {color:#348CBC; text-decoration:underline; font-weight:bold; }
.link1:hover {text-decoration:none;}

.link2 {color:#7F8D95; text-decoration:underline; font-weight:bold;}
.link2:hover {text-decoration:none;}

/*LINKS END*/
/*TXT START*/
.txt1 { color:#FFFFFF; font-size:24px; line-height:24px; font-family:"Times New Roman", Times, serif}
.txt2{color:#FFFFFF; line-height:13px;}
.txt3{color:#4E4F50;font-size:24px; line-height:24px; font-family:"Times New Roman", Times, serif}
.txt4{color:#B0B0B0;}
/*TXT END*/
/******************--for each pages classes--***************************************/
#page1 #content .col1 .indent{ margin-left:26px; margin-top:5px; margin-right:15px;}
#page1 #content .col2 .indent{ margin-left:18px; margin-top:5px;}
#page1 #content .col3 .indent{ margin-left:18px; margin-top:5px;}

#page2 #content .col1 .indent{ margin-left:26px; margin-top:5px; margin-right:20px;}
#page2 #content .col2 .indent{ margin-left:18px; margin-top:5px;}

#page3 #content .col1 .indent{ margin-left:26px; margin-top:5px; margin-right:20px;}
#page3 #content .col2 .indent{ margin-left:18px; margin-top:5px;}

#page4 #content .col1 .indent{ margin-left:26px; margin-top:5px; margin-right:15px;}
#page4 #content .col2 .indent{ margin-left:18px; margin-top:5px; margin-right:10px;}
#page4 #content .col3 .indent{ margin-left:18px; margin-top:5px;}

#page5 #content .col1 .indent{ margin-left:26px; margin-top:5px; margin-right:20px;}
#page5 #content .col2 .indent{ margin-left:18px; margin-top:5px;}

#page6 #content .col1 .indent{ margin-left:26px; margin-top:5px;}
#page6 #content .col2 .indent{ margin-left:18px; margin-top:5px; margin-right:10px;}
#page6 #content .col3 .indent{ margin-left:18px; margin-top:5px; margin-right:5px;}
.h{height:30px;}

#page7 #content .col1 .indent{ margin-left:26px; margin-top:5px;}

/******************************** MENUE NESTED STYLE **********************************/

	/*Credits: Dynamic Drive CSS Library */
	/*URL: http://www.dynamicdrive.com/style/ */
	
	.sidebarmenu ul{
	margin: 0;
	padding: 0;
	list-style-type: none;
	font-stretch:expanded;
	font: icon 13px Verdana;
	width: 185px; /* Main Menu Item widths */
	}
	
	.sidebarmenu ul li{
	position: relative;
	background:url(images/spacer.gif) no-repeat 0px 0px;
	padding-left:0px; line-height:0px;
	color:#348CBC;
	padding: 0px;
	}
		
	/* Top level menu links style */
	.sidebarmenu ul li a{
	display: block;
	overflow: auto; /*force hasLayout in IE7 */
	color: white;
	text-decoration: none;
	padding: 0px;
	}
	
	.sidebarmenu ul li a:link, .sidebarmenu ul li a:visited, .sidebarmenu ul li a:active{
	background-color:#7F8D95 /*background of tabs (default state)*/
	}
	
	.sidebarmenu ul li a:visited{
	color: white;
	}
	
	.sidebarmenu ul li a:hover{
	background-color:#CCCCCC;
	}
	
	/*Sub level menu items */
	.sidebarmenu ul li ul{
	text-indent:20px;
	text-decoration:none;
	position: absolute;
	width: 145px; /*Sub Menu Items width */
	top: 0;
	visibility: hidden;
	}
	
	.sidebarmenu ul li ul li{
	top: 0px;
	padding-bottom: 0px;
	background:url(images/spacer.gif) no-repeat 0px 0px;
	}
	
	.sidebarmenu ul li ul li a{
	height:29px; /*height of the second order menue*/
	line-height: 29px;
	}
	
	/* Holly Hack for IE \\*/
	* html .sidebarmenu ul li { float: left; height: 1%; }
	* html .sidebarmenu ul li a { height: 1%; }
	/* End */
	


/*Credits: Dynamic Drive CSS Library */
/*URL: http://www.dynamicdrive.com/style/ */
.floatimgleft {
float:left;
margin-top:10px;
margin-right:10px;
margin-bottom:10px;
}

.thumbnail{
position: relative;
z-index: 0;
}

.thumbnail:hover{
background-color: transparent;
z-index: 500;
}

.thumbnail span{ /*CSS for enlarged image*/
position: absolute;
background-color: lightyellow;
padding: 5px;
left: -1000px;
width: 500px;
border: 1px dashed gray;
visibility: hidden;
color: black;
text-decoration: none;
}

.thumbnail span img{ /*CSS for enlarged image*/
border-width: 0;
padding: 2px;
}

.thumbnail:hover span{ /*CSS for enlarged image on hover*/
visibility: visible;
top: -40px;
left: 60px; /*position where enlarged image should offset horizontally */
}

.thumbnail1{
position: relative;
z-index: 0;
}

.thumbnail1:hover{
background-color: transparent;
z-index: 500;
}

.thumbnail1 span{ /*CSS for enlarged image*/
position: absolute;
background-color: lightyellow;
padding: 5px;
left: -1000px;
width: 500px;
border: 1px dashed gray;
visibility: hidden;
color: black;
text-decoration: none;
}

.thumbnail1 span img{ /*CSS for enlarged image*/
border-width: 1;
padding: 2px;
}

.thumbnail1:hover span{ /*CSS for enlarged image on hover*/
visibility: visible;
top: -100px;
left: -360px; /*position where enlarged image should offset horizontally */

}

/*styles for dhtml radio windows*/
div.sample_popup { z-index: 1; }

div.sample_popup div.menu_form_header
{
  border: 1px solid black;
  border-bottom: none;
  width: 249px;
  height:      20px;
  line-height: 19px;
  vertical-align: middle;
  text-decoration: none;
  
  font-family: Times New Roman, Serif;
  font-weight: 900;
  font-size:  13px; color:#FFFFFF;
  cursor: pointer;
  background-color: #999999;
}

div.sample_popup div.menu_form_body
{
  width: 249px;
  height: 125px;
  border: 1px solid black;
}

div.sample_popup img.menu_form_exit
{
  float:  right;
  margin: 4px 5px 0px 0px;
  cursor: pointer;
}


/*border shadow style */
.shadow{
border:1px solid silver;
font:10pt arial;
position:relative;
display:inline;
background:white;
z-index:100
}

.shadow_inner{
overflow:hidden;
position:absolute;
top: -1000px;
filter:alpha(Opacity=10); /*modify to change the shade solidity/opacity, same as below*/
opacity:0.1; /*firefox 1.5 opacity*/
-moz-opacity:0.1; /*mozilla opacity*/
-khtml-opacity:0.1; /*opacity*/
z-index:10
}


	



